TEM4 (Test for English Majors-Band 4) is one of the important English proficiency tests for college English majors in China. It links and evaluates the status quo of the teaching and learning process, provides feedback and guide for teachers and students. The impact of testing on teaching is called the backwash effect, which includes both positive and negative aspects. This paper analyzes the positive and negative backwash effects TEM4 brings to the teaching and learning of Comprehensive English, one of the core courses for English majors, and discusses how to exert its positive effect and reduce the negative effect to promote teaching effectiveness, help students improve their language knowledge and skills to prepare for more effective examinations.
